After driving a raptor in two wheel drive, in AWD and with traction control off on the pavement I think its WAY slow. Throttle response is slow and doesnt seem to make power unless the engine is screaming. It might feel better in a truck that isn't so heavy. I hated it... until I took it offroad. I was actually impressed. Not so much with the engine but the suspension, it actually works. When the truck leaves the ground you expect a harsh landing but it loves it.
It is the slowest 400 hp Ive ever seen. I think my dads f350 with a mild 6.0 powerstroke would take it all day long. Don't buy this and think your going to beat up on anything save for a prius.
